    2026–2027 Enhancing Access to Spaces for Everyone Grant

    Apply by May 7, 2026

    About

    A funding program providing financial support for projects aimed at enhancing accessibility in community spaces, specifically targeting municipalities, not-for-profit organizations, and Indigenous communities. Eligible projects can receive significant funding to implement retrofits that improve participation for older adults and individuals with disabilities, with a focus on exceeding existing accessibility standards.

    Benefits

    • 💰Financial Support
      Eligible projects may receive up to $60,000 for small capital projects
    • 🏗️ Retrofit Funding
      Funding for retrofits to help older adults and people with disabilities participate in community life
    • Priority Projects
      Projects that exceed the Accessibility for Ontarians with Disabilities Act, 2005 (AODA) and/or the Ontario Building Code are prioritized

    Eligibility Criteria

    • Open to municipalities
    • Incorporated not-for-profit organizations are eligible
    • Indigenous communities can apply

    Participation Commitments

    • Applicants must attend one of the four webinars hosted during the application window
    • Projects must be completed within the grant period
    • Applicants must apply online through the Transfer Payment Ontario (TPON) website
